Middle Childhood Generalist Endorsement

To obtain the generalist endorsement, candidates must complete all courses indicated for the subject area and pass the PRAXIS II Elementary Content Knowledge Exam (Test # 0014) or the Praxis II Middle Childhood content exam (test codes listed above) appropriate for the area(s) to be added. Candidates must also maintain a minimum 2.8 GPA in each added subject area.

Only BGSU undergraduate/initial licensure students may take undergraduate courses toward the endorsement. Those already having their license must take these classes at the postbaccalaureate/ graduate level. Content taken at other institutions may be approved by petition based on faculty/College of Education and Human Development review of both the student’s grades and a detailed course description or syllabus of the courses to be substituted.

Upon satisfactory completion of endorsement coursework (2.8 GPA), students students should submit to the EDHD Office of Accreditation and Licensure (455 Education):

  1. An Ohio Department of Education Licensure Application

  2. Associated fees.

  3. An official transcript of final grades

  4. An official Praxis II score report confirming passage of the exam.

The Program Coordinator will verify compliance, and the Licensure Officer will finalize paperwork and submit it to the Ohio Department of Education for review.
